   X-rays could be executed to further more assess the joint or bony alterations, and to help diagnose any fundamental orthopedic problems.  Sometimes, additional Innovative imaging could possibly be carried out to raised Appraise the cartilage and also other delicate tissue buildings encompassing the bone that don't clearly show up on X-rays. To examine Those people regions, your veterinarian will schedule an arthroscopy, CT or MRI.   Treatment  The intention of treatment is to attenuate pain, gradual the development of harm, and keep or produce muscle mass. Treatment is accomplished with a mix of therapies, which can consist of any of the subsequent:   Way of living modifications:   Fat control  Very low-impression functions, for instance leash walks or swimming  Usage of non-slip rugs and ramps to receive on beds, couches or autos   Physical rehabilitation:   Underwater treadmill  Array of motion workout routines or other therapeutic modalities — like acupuncture, LASER therapy and more   Pain management:   NSAIDs (n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s) are commonly prescribed prescription drugs to control OA pain and inflammation. Your Pet dog will require schedule checking with blood operate when they have to have very long-expression NSAIDs.    Added drugs, for example gabapentin and amantadine, may very well be provided in combination with NSAIDs. Librela (bedinvetmab) is usually a variety of injectable medication often called a monoclonal antibody that could be supplied once month-to-month to deliver extended-term Charge of OA pain. It targets a specific driver of OA pain referred to as nerve advancement issue (NGF). Joint support:    Supplements, including glucosamine and chondroitin sulfate, and omega-three fatty acids  Joint injections, like platelet-abundant plasma, stem mobile therapy or RSO (radiosynoviorthesis or brand name Synovetin OA)  Operation:   Could possibly be recommended for some situations which have fundamental triggers of OA, which include hip dysplasia, cranial cruciate ligament rupture and elbow dysplasia, amongst Some others   Consequence  OA causes progressive harm to influenced joints, and the prognosis differs based on the fundamental induce and severity. Whilst there is not any overcome for OA, there are many means to handle pain and delay its progression, making it possible for numerous dogs to Reside comfortably having a multimodal method of treatment.   The earlier OA is diagnosed and managed prior to the severe development of OA, the greater the extended-time period final result.   Image offered.

Overview  Arthritis, or osteoarthritis (OA), is really a Serious and progressive joint disorder that generally impacts dogs. This degenerative affliction makes dogs reduce their joint cartilage, resulting in other modifications inside their bones and producing pain, inflammation and issue utilizing the afflicted limb.   OA is not only a disorder that occurs in senior dogs and may establish at any age, especially in dogs with contributing variables, like weight problems or other orthopedic disorders.   Whilst there isn't a cure for OA, there are various procedures for slowing its development, managing mobility and minimizing pain.   Lead to  Joints Ordinarily contain both fluid and cartilage, which cushion the human body from forces through movement — allowing easy, fluid movement without the friction of rubbing on bone.   With OA, joint fluid decreases and cartilage thins, cutting down the joints’ shock-absorbing capability. Given that the cartilage progressively deteriorates, bony alterations around the joint build, leading to additional inflammation, pain, stiffness and issue using the joint.  Several components add to the development of OA. Usually There's multiple induce, but sometimes, there may be no obvious fundamental induce. Numerous orthopedic health conditions may possibly bring on the development of OA by leading to repetitive injuries to your joint cartilage — which include hip dysplasia, elbow dysplasia, patella luxation, cranial cruciate ligament problems, prior fractures, repetitive large-effect actions and more.   Being overweight contributes substantially to the development of OA as a result of extra force put on joints. Body fat cells also deliver inflammatory mediators, which worsens the progression of OA.   Medical signs  The signs of OA may perhaps vary from gentle to intense depending on the chronicity and range of joints affected. Indications may perhaps contain any of the next: Pain  Stiffness  Lameness or simply a alter in gait   Lower in action or reluctance to walk, operate or training  Problems navigating stairs or jumping on couches  Problems acquiring up from lying down  Muscle losing  Sudden modifications in behavior, like irritability or aggression  Analysis  OA is diagnosed following a Bodily Examination, in which your veterinarian will observe your dog's gait and posture, and feel for any irregular improvements on the joints or indications of pain.
